Yesterday I finished the first of my 7 PhD scrap quilts - here it is on the couch with our oldest son's girlfriend hiding under it, while the cat looks on, lol. It measures 54X72", and is backed with turquoise blue fleece. It's just a simple throw, tied in the intersections with blue buttons. It will be going to a local shelter here in town, so hopefully someone will be snuggling under it within the next few days :)
Thanks for the inspiration, Myra --- I'm already working on PhD #2!
